What is RTP and Why It Matters

Return to Player (RTP) is one of the most important metrics you should understand before spinning the reels at any online casino. This percentage tells you how much money a slot machine returns to players over time, making it a crucial factor in choosing which games to play.

How RTP Works

If a slot has an RTP of 96%, it means that theoretically, for every $100 wagered, players will receive $96 back over thousands of spins. The remaining 4% represents the house edge. It’s important to remember that RTP is calculated over extended periods—individual sessions can vary wildly from these averages.
